Roasted Butternut Squash Recipe (Step-by-Step) | HowToCook.Recipes
This super easy roasted butternut squash recipe is the perfect holiday classic side dish that always has the whole family coming back for seconds! This classic has fresh rosemary and sage with maple syrup that comes out perfectly caramelized.

Ingredients:
1 large butternut squash (about 3 lbs) (diced into 1 inch cubes)
2 tsp kosher salt
1 tsp black pepper
1 1/2 tbsp fresh rosemary (chopped)
1/2 tbsp fresh sage (chopped)
1 tsp cinnamon
2 tbsp maple syrup
2 1/2 tbsp extra virgin olive oil
Instructions:
1. Preheat your oven to 375F and prepare 2 baking sheets with parchment paper.
2. In a large mixing bowl, toss the butternut squash cubes with the olive oil and remaining ingredients. Make sure everything is evenly coated. Spread the cubes in an even, single layer on your prepared baking sheets.
3. Place in the oven for about 25-30 minutes, tossing halfway to ensure even roasting. Continue baking until the squash is fork tender, this make take an additional 10 minutes depending on your oven. Remove from the oven, sprinkle with a little more rosemary, sage, and kosher salt to taste. Serve immediately.

Butternut Squash Pasta Casserole
RECIPE COURTESY OF REE DRUMMOND
Level: Easy
Total: 1 hr
Active: 15 min
Yield: 6 to 8 servings
Ingredients
1 pound short pasta, such as penne, gemelli or trofie
2 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
1 medium onion, chopped
2 cups frozen diced butternut squash
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
1 quart chicken or vegetable stock
1 cup frozen peas
1 jarred roasted red pepper, finely chopped
One 4-ounce log fresh goat cheese, broken into small pieces
1 small head cauliflower, grated on the large holes of a box grater
1 cup shredded mozzarella
1/4 cup grated Parmesan
3 tablespoons minced fresh parsley
Directions
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F.
Cook the pasta in boiling water to not quite al dente according to the package directions. Drain and transfer to a casserole dish.
Add the olive oil to a large pot over medium-high heat. When the oil is hot, add the onion and cook for a minute or so to slightly soften. Add the butternut squash and season with salt and pepper. Pour in the stock, bring to a boil, reduce to a simmer and cook until the squash has softened, about 5 minutes. Puree in the pot with an immersion blender.
Stir the squash mixture into the casserole dish with the pasta, then mix in the peas, red pepper and goat cheese. Cover the pasta mixture with the grated cauliflower, then season with salt and pepper. Top with the mozzarella, Parmesan and half the parsley.
Bake until the casserole is browned and bubbling, 40 to 45 minutes. Sprinkle with the remaining parsley.

Butternut Squash Casserole #squashcasserole
Preheat oven 325*F
Prepare large fresh butternut
As shown on video.
Bake for 1 hour
Scoop squash out into bowl
Add:
1 cup brown sugar
1/3 cup milk
1/4 cup melted butter
2 eggs beaten
1/2 teaspoon Cinnamon
1/4 teaspoon each of, Allspice, Cloves and salt
1 tsp vanilla
Mix well by hand
Topping:
1/4 brown sugar
1/4 cup plain flour
3 Tablespoons butter
1/2 cup chopped pecan
Bake for 30 minutes. Serve after sets 10 minutes
